Requests for Information in the TeamLink™ Portal
View, submit, respond to, and resolve RFIs directly through the TeamLink Portal
BACKGROUND
Requests for Information are a critical part of keeping construction projects moving. Through the ConstructionOnline™ Portal, TeamLink Users with the appropriate access can stay on top of project RFIs without ever leaving the Portal—viewing RFI details, submitting new requests, posting responses, marking RFIs as resolved, and more.
THINGS TO CONSIDER
-
Access to RFIs in the Portal requires an existing TeamLink User account. If you do not currently have access, contact the builder to be added as the appropriate Portal user.
- RFIs displayed in the Portal reflect those assigned to the TeamLink User; available actions may vary based on the builder's TeamLink permissions settings.
⚠️ Important: RFIs serve as formal project documents—once an RFI has been created, actions to the RFI cannot be reversed. This ensures the integrity of the RFI record is maintained throughout the project.
From the Portal RFI section, you can:
- Filter and view RFIs associated with the project
- Reply to existing RFIs
- Mark RFIs as Resolved or Unresolved
- Reopen RFIs
- Create new RFIs
- Print RFIs
HOW TO USE REQUESTS FOR INFORMATION IN THE PORTAL
Access RFIs:
- Navigate to the desired project's Requests for Information from within the Portal.

- This will open the RFIs feature, displaying the RFI Status Breakdown and RFIs list.
Filter RFIs:
- Click "Filters" in the upper left corner of the RFIs list to expand the Filters panel.

- Filter RFIs by Due Date, Authored By, Recipient, Assigned Resource, Complexity, Trade, Status, or Tags to narrow the list to the most relevant RFIs.

To clear established Filters, you can -
- Select the white X next to the specific Filter category you want to revert back to "All."
- Use the blue "Clear Filters" text next to the ❌ to reset the table to the default filters of "All" for each category.
View an RFI:

Reply to an RFI:
- Select the desired RFI from the list.
- Click the blue "Reply to Selected RFI" text in the upper right corner of the RFIs list.

- Enter your response in the textbox and attach any supporting Files as needed using the "Attach Files" option.

- Click the blue "Post Response" button to send your reply.
Mark an RFI as Resolved or Unresolved:
- Select the desired RFI from the list.
- At the bottom of the RFI details, click Mark RFI as: Resolved or Mark RFI as: Unresolved as appropriate.

- Once marked, the RFI status will be dated and will update in the list—a green thumbs up icon indicates a Resolved RFI, while a red thumbs down icon indicates an Unresolved RFI.
Reopen an RFI:
- Select the desired RFI from the list.
- Click the gray 3-dot Action Menu in the upper right corner of the RFI and select "Reopen RFI" from the dropdown.

- In the "Choose Action for Unresolved RFI" window, select the preferred action:

- Send another question to current Contact — allows you to send a follow-up to the existing contact.
- Send RFI to additional Contact(s) — route the RFI to one or more new contacts.
- Click the blue "Continue" button to complete the desired action.
Create an RFI:
- Click the green (+) Add RFI button.

- In the "New Request for Information" window, enter the RFI details, including -
- Details:
- Related Project: Displays the project the RFI is associated with. ConstructionOnline automatically populates this field and it cannot be modified.
- To: Enter the ConstructionOnline contact(s) the RFI is being sent to. This field is required.
- Number: The RFI number which is auto-assigned sequentially; can be adjusted if needed.
- Subject: Enter a brief, descriptive title for the RFI.
- Authored By: The contact who is creating the request. By default, ConstructionOnline populates the current user.
- Assigned To: The contact responsible for responding to the RFI.
- Due Date: The date by which a response is needed.
- Added Days: Indicate any additional days required as a result of this RFI.
- Drawing Number: Reference the relevant drawing(s) associated with the RFI.
- Location: Specify the location on the project the RFI pertains to.
- Trade: Select the applicable trade.
- Complexity: Set the complexity level of the RFI: Low, Medium, or High.
- Cost Impact: Enter an estimated cost impact, or check "To Be Determined" if unknown.
- Cost Code: Associate a Cost Code with the RFI
- Tags: Add tags to help organize and filter RFIs.
- CC: Add any additional contacts to be copied on the RFI.
- Question/Clarification Needed: Enter the full question or description of the information being requested. This field is required.
- Attachments: Attach any supporting Files or Photos to the RFI as needed.
- Details:
- Click either the blue "Create RFI" button to create the RFI or the "Create RFI & Send Emails" button to notify recipients immediately.

Print an RFI:
- Select the desired RFI from the list.
- Click the gray 3-dot Action Menu in the upper right corner of the RFI and select "Print RFI" from the dropdown.

- This will open the "Create RFI Summary" window, where you can configure the report settings, including -
- Select Project: Confirm the associated project.
- Select Individual RFI or All RFIs: Choose to print a single RFI or all RFIs for the project.
- Select Sort Type: Choose how RFIs are sorted in the report.
- Filter By: Narrow the report by Status, Trade, Author, Recipient, Assigned Resource, or Complexity.
- Attachments: Choose whether to include File and Photo attachments, and whether to display one RFI per page.
- Page Orientation: Select Portrait or Landscape.
- Click the blue "Create" to generate the RFI summary report in a new browser tab.
- Click the "Print" button in the upper right corner to configure your printer settings and print the RFI(s).

Export RFIs:
- Click the gray 3-dot Action Menu in the upper right corner of the RFIs list.
- Select "Export to Excel" from the dropdown.
- ConstructionOnline will automatically download the RFIs list as an Excel (.XLSX) file to your device.

ADDITIONAL INFORMATION
- Permissions: TeamLink Portal permissions are managed by ConstructionOnline Company Users. If you have questions about your level of access within the Portal, contact the general contractor directly.
- CO™ Mobile App: The RFI feature is available via the mobile app.
